Thomas Cook (India) Limited informed the exchanges that its wholly owned material subsidiary, Sterling Holiday Resorts Limited (SHRL), has received shareholder approval to shift its registered office from Chennai, Tamil Nadu to Mumbai, Maharashtra. The approval was granted at an Extraordinary General Meeting held on January 5, 2026. The new office will be located at Andheri (E), Mumbai, while the existing office in Thoraipakkam, Chennai will be vacated. The shift is subject to completion of required regulatory formalities.
